Aspects of control and complementation in Turkish
Yasavul, Şevket Murat; Bozşahin, Hüseyin Cem; Department of Cognitive Sciences (2009)
This thesis investigates fundamental questions surrounding the phenomenon of control, with an emphasis on control in Turkish, as well as the behaviour of control verbs in non-infinitival environments, which have received little attention previously. I focus solely on the cases of obligatory control (OC) which constitute the only kind of control that is conditioned by the matrix verb alone. This approach is couched in Combinatory Categorial Grammar (CCG) where the control verb projects the necessary syntacti...
Aspects of silver tolerance in bacteria: infrared spectral changes and epigenetic clues
Gurbanov, Rafig; Ozek, Nihal S.; Tunçer, Sinem; Severcan, Feride; Gözen, Ayşe Gül (2018-05-01)
In this study, the molecular profile changes leading to the adaptation of bacteria to survive and grow at inhibitory silver concentration were explored. The profile obtained through infrared (IR)-based measurements indicated extensive changes in all biomolecular components, which were supported by chemometric techniques. The changes in biomolecular profile were prominent, including nucleic acids. The changes in nucleic acid region (1350-950 cm(-1)) were encountered as a clue for conformational change in DNA...
